FUGITIVE TURK A KING
' ',r' " Enver Pasha, a Pro-German, Has Accepted Kurd's*; Throne. Enver Pasha, former Turkish minlater of war, has been crowned king of Kurdistan, the Turkish region lying between Mesopotamia and Persia. Kurdistan Is an extensive region with ill-defined borders. Its population indudes 2,000,000 people, most of whom are Mohammedans. Enver Pasha was minister of war In the Turkish cabinet from January. 1914, to October, 1918. He was leader of the Young Turks* an ardent proGerman and an enthusiastic pupil of the German general von der Goltz. After the signing of the armistice Enver fled from Constantinople to Berlin in disguise. He was arrested on request of the Turkish government, but escaped. Though a sentence of ..death rests over him for acts committed during the war, he is a king and probably will escape punishment
